PHILIPSBURG:---  Caretaker Minister of Finance Hon. Perry Geerlings has developed a detailed proposal to grow the economy through a stimulus for micro-, small and medium-sized enterprises.

The proposal was developed as part of the World Bank project to enhance financing possibilities for enterprises in Sint Maarten.

It was recently submitted for final approval to the Steering Committee of the Trust Fund.

In November 2018, the Steering Committee of the Sint Maarten Recovery and Resilience Trust Fund approved an Enterprise Recovery Project.
